Longest and shortest day in Tripoli

In Tripoli, Libya, the longest day of 2026 is around the June solstice on Sunday, 21 June 2026, with 14h 19m of daylight, and the shortest is around the December solstice on Monday, 21 December 2026, with 9h 59m.

Tripoli sunrise, sunset and day length on the 2026 solstices and equinoxes, in local time
Turning pointDateSunriseSunsetDay length
March equinoxFriday, 20 March 202607:1119:1812h 8m
June solsticeSunday, 21 June 202605:5920:1814h 19m
September equinoxTuesday, 22 September 202606:5519:0412h 9m
December solsticeMonday, 21 December 202608:0518:049h 59m

Why the day gets longer and shorter in Tripoli

Earth's axis is tilted about 23.4 degrees, so as the planet orbits the Sun, Tripoli leans toward the Sun for part of the year and away for the rest. When it leans toward the Sun the days lengthen and the Sun climbs higher; half a year later the opposite happens. The size of the swing depends on how far Tripoli sits from the equator: the further away, the bigger the difference between the longest and shortest day.

Frequently asked questions about day length in Tripoli

When is the longest day in Tripoli?

The longest day in Tripoli falls around the June solstice, on Sunday, 21 June 2026 in 2026, with about 14h 19m of daylight, sunrise at 05:59 and sunset at 20:18.

When is the shortest day in Tripoli?

The shortest day in Tripoli falls around the December solstice, on Monday, 21 December 2026 in 2026, with about 9h 59m of daylight, sunrise at 08:05 and sunset at 18:04.

How much does day length change through the year in Tripoli?

Between the longest and shortest day, Tripoli gains and loses about 4h 20m of daylight. The change is fastest around the March and September equinoxes and slowest near the solstices.
